The petition calling for a veto on the draft law adopted by the Verkhovna Rada on the restoration of mandatory electronic declaration received the required number of votes.

This is evidenced by the data on the petitions page at the president’s website of Ukraine.

As of 8:50 p.m., almost 30,000 people supported the petition.

It is worth noting that the proposal was registered on the president’s website only a few hours ago.

The author of the petition noted that the deputies, by leaving the information about the property of officials closed for another year, “deprived citizens and journalists of a tool for monitoring the actions of officials and the main safeguard against corruption during the war.”

We will remind you that draft law No. 9534 on the restoration of electronic declaration for officials was adopted on September 5. At the same time, the Council failed amendment No. 371 on the immediate opening of officials’ declarations – it received only 199 votes.

Later it became known which of the People’s Deputies voted against the important amendment. President Volodymyr Zelenskyi has already answered the question about whether he will sign the law without amendment.
